WebMay 27, 2014 · Clearly, the legal definition of obscenity intends to cover anything which is depraved, and is not limited to sexual depravity. Section 2 (1) of the Obscene Publications Act 1959 (OPA) makes it an offence to publish an ‘obscene article’, whether for gain or not.
